What Is Math Playground Wheely?

Math Playground Wheely is an online game that merges math concepts with a puzzle-based driving challenge. Players control a little red car named Wheely, navigating through a series of obstacles and puzzles that require logic, critical thinking, and sometimes simple arithmetic to overcome. The game encourages players to think creatively and strategically about how to move Wheely through each level.

Unlike traditional math drills, this game is designed to be immersive and interactive, using visual cues and increasingly complex challenges to keep players engaged. It’s suitable for elementary and middle school students who want to sharpen their problem-solving skills in a playful environment.

How Does Wheely Help with Math Learning?

While Wheely isn’t a direct math drill like multiplication flashcards or fraction worksheets, it indirectly supports math skills development through:

  • Critical Thinking: Players must analyze obstacles and devise a sequence of moves, similar to solving math problems step by step.
  • Spatial Reasoning: Navigating Wheely through tight spaces enhances understanding of shapes, angles, and spatial relationships.
  • Logical Sequencing: Planning moves in order mirrors the logical flow of solving equations or word problems.

This makes Wheely an excellent complementary tool for students who benefit from visual and kinesthetic learning styles.

Exploring the Gameplay and Features of Math Playground Wheely

The charm of Math Playground Wheely lies in its simple yet clever design. Each level presents a unique puzzle that requires players to use physics concepts like gravity, momentum, and balance, alongside logical reasoning.

Levels and Difficulty

The game starts with easy levels that introduce basic mechanics such as moving forward, jumping, and interacting with objects. As players progress, the puzzles become more complex, incorporating:

  • Levers and pulleys
  • Switches to activate platforms
  • Timed challenges requiring quick decision-making

This gradual increase in difficulty helps maintain interest and provides a rewarding sense of accomplishment.

Visual and Audio Elements

The game’s bright, cartoonish graphics make it accessible to younger audiences, while the sound effects and simple music add to the immersive experience without being distracting. These sensory elements help keep players motivated and focused.

Understanding Math Playground Wheely

At its core, Math Playground Wheely is an interactive puzzle game where players control a small red car navigating through a series of increasingly complex levels. The objective is to maneuver Wheely past obstacles and traps by applying logical reasoning, spatial awareness, and basic math skills. Unlike traditional math drills, Wheely emphasizes critical thinking and spatial problem-solving, which are essential components of mathematical proficiency but often overlooked in conventional curricula.

The integration of physics-based challenges and intuitive controls sets Wheely apart from more standard math games. Players must anticipate the car’s movement, plan routes, and sometimes use trial and error to progress. This hands-on experience reinforces mathematical concepts indirectly, making the learning process feel less like a chore and more like a puzzle to be solved.

Key Features and Gameplay Mechanics

One of the standout features of Math Playground Wheely is its user-friendly interface. The game is designed to be accessible for children aged 7 and up, but its increasing level of difficulty keeps older students engaged as well. Among its defining characteristics are:

  • Progressive Difficulty: Levels start simple, introducing players to the mechanics, and gradually introduce more complex obstacles such as moving platforms, switches, and teleporters.
  • Physics-Based Challenges: The car’s movement respects basic physical principles, requiring players to consider momentum and timing.
  • Visual and Audio Feedback: Clear animations and sound effects provide immediate feedback on successes and failures, enhancing user engagement.
  • Accessible Controls: Simple arrow keys or touchscreen inputs ensure that children can focus on problem-solving rather than struggling with controls.

These features collectively contribute to a learning environment where mathematical thinking is seamlessly integrated into play.

Comparison with Other Math Playground Games

Math Playground offers a wide range of games targeting different math skills, from arithmetic drills to logic puzzles. When compared to titles such as “Number Ninja” or “Fraction Fling,” Wheely stands out by focusing less on direct computation and more on problem-solving and reasoning.

  • Number Ninja: Primarily targets arithmetic fluency through fast-paced number operations.
  • Fraction Fling: Focuses on fraction comparison and manipulation using a catapult mechanic.
  • Wheely: Emphasizes spatial navigation and logic puzzles with minimal direct math calculations.

This diversity allows educators to select games that align with specific learning objectives, and Wheely’s unique approach complements more traditional math games by broadening the cognitive skills engaged.

User Experience and Accessibility

Math Playground Wheely is accessible via web browsers without requiring downloads, making it convenient for classroom and home use. The game’s design is compatible with both desktop and mobile devices, accommodating varying technology environments.

From a user experience perspective, the game strikes a balance between challenge and accessibility. Early levels ensure that even younger players can succeed, while later stages introduce enough complexity to maintain interest. The absence of time limits reduces pressure, allowing learners to experiment and learn at their own pace.

However, some users note that the lack of explicit math instruction within the game can be a drawback for those seeking direct skill reinforcement. Unlike games that provide step-by-step guidance or immediate explanations of math concepts, Wheely’s learning is implicit and requires reflective discussion or supplementary teaching to maximize benefits.

Pros and Cons of Math Playground Wheely

  • Pros:
    • Engaging and interactive gameplay that motivates learners.
    • Develops critical thinking, logic, and spatial reasoning skills.
    • Progressive difficulty maintains interest over time.
    • Accessible across multiple devices without installation.
  • Cons:
    • Lacks explicit math instruction or feedback on mathematical concepts.
    • May require adult facilitation to connect gameplay with curriculum goals.
    • Limited replay value once all levels are completed.

These considerations highlight the importance of integrating Wheely within a broader educational framework rather than relying on it as a standalone learning tool.
